Output 83d133467e2cc5629dbefbc1879d4148d853a61d2ecc9c7081e8cc7785feb29e:0

value
592433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a98ef55620939831e7fc3eb6e49a383adbaf3c3 OP_EQUAL
address
3EKrP7sRix5uzwcJuXGAV76rbfpNXWsn7o
transaction
83d133467e2cc5629dbefbc1879d4148d853a61d2ecc9c7081e8cc7785feb29e
confirmations
106727
spent
true